Pathariya Assembly Election Result 1985

Madhya Pradesh ·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ly) Election 1985

Shyamlal of Indian National Congress won the Pathariya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ency in Madhya Pradesh in the 1985 state assembly election, securing 17,050 votes (49.30% vote share). The runner-up was Nandram Choudhary (Bharatiya Janata Party) with 12,336 votes.

A total of 12 candidates contested this assembly seat. Top Candidates (Votes)
Constituency Details
  • State: Madhya Pradesh
  • Constituency: Pathariya
  • Constituency Number: 54
  • District: Damoh
  • Total Contestants: 12
  • Election Year: 1985
  • Election Type: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ly)
Position Candidate Name Votes Votes% Party
1 Shyamlal 17050 49.30% Indian National Congress
2 Nandram Choudhary 12336 35.60% Bharatiya Janata Party
3 Mool Chand 2243 6.50% Communist Party Of India
4 Barelal 790 2.30% Independent
5 Komal Prasad Basore 582 1.70% Janta Party
6 Dayaldas 426 1.20% Independent
7 Onkar Prasad 393 1.10% Independent
8 Jeewanlal 335 1.00% Independent
9 Deojoo 156 0.50% Independent
10 Ramdas Kori 149 0.40% Independent
11 Dhaniram 83 0.20% Independent
12 Shyamle 69 0.20% Independent
